        I hate to be the Akshually guy but they’re truly not laws. They’re directives for the federal agencies under the control of the executive branch. They have the " force of law " (assuming they’re aligned with the constitutional authority of the president) but they’re not laws.

        They don’t create crimes, do budgets, or override congress.
